Low Latency Java Developer in London

Low Latency Java Developer in London

London Full-Time 80000 - 100000 £ / year (est.) No working from home possible
Synechron

At a Glance

  • Tasks: Design and develop ultra-fast trading systems using Java for the Capital Markets.
  • Company: Join a dynamic team at the forefront of trading technology.
  • Benefits: Competitive salary, flexible work options, and opportunities for professional growth.
  • Other info: Collaborative environment with a focus on innovation and performance.
  • Why this job: Make a real impact in high-frequency trading with cutting-edge technology.
  • Qualifications: 10+ years in software development, especially in trading systems and low latency programming.

The predicted salary is between 80000 - 100000 £ per year.

We are seeking a highly experienced Low Latency Java Developer to join our dynamic team. The ideal candidate will have a proven track record of developing low latency trading systems within the Capital Markets domain. This role requires extensive experience in building scalable, high-performance trading infrastructure, with an emphasis on minimizing latency and maximizing throughput.

Key Responsibilities:
  • Design, develop, and maintain low latency trading systems using Java.
  • Collaborate with quantitative teams, traders, and infrastructure teams to optimize systems for ultra-low latency execution.
  • Implement real-time data processing, messaging, and order management solutions.
  • Conduct performance tuning and latency profiling to identify bottlenecks and optimize code.
  • Ensure system stability, reliability, and scalability under high-volume trading conditions.
  • Contribute to architecture design and best practices in low latency Java development.
  • Stay updated with the latest trends and technologies in algorithmic trading and high-frequency trading.
Qualifications & Skills:
  • Minimum 10 years of experience in software development.
  • Proven experience working within Capital Markets, specifically in trading systems, order execution, or market data handling.
  • Extensive expertise in Java, with a strong understanding of low latency programming techniques and performance optimization.
  • Experience with high-performance data structures, multithreading, and concurrent programming in Java.
  • Familiarity with network protocols and hardware optimization for low latency.
  • Strong understanding of market data feeds, FIX protocol, and trading infrastructure is a plus.
  • Excellent problem-solving skills and meticulous attention to detail.
  • Bachelor's degree in computer science, Engineering, or a related field; advanced degrees are a plus.

Low Latency Java Developer in London employer: Synechron

Join a leading firm in the Capital Markets sector, where as a Low Latency Java Developer, you will thrive in a collaborative and innovative environment. We offer competitive salaries, comprehensive benefits, and ample opportunities for professional growth, all while working in a fast-paced location that champions cutting-edge technology and fosters a culture of excellence and teamwork.

Synechron

Contact Details:

Synechron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Low Latency Java Developer in London

Tip Number 1

Network like a pro! Attend industry meetups, conferences, or webinars related to low latency trading and Java development. It's a great way to meet potential employers and get your name out there.

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those related to low latency systems. This can really set you apart when chatting with recruiters or during interviews.

Tip Number 3

Practice makes perfect! Brush up on your coding skills and be ready for technical interviews. Use platforms that offer coding challenges to simulate the real deal and keep your skills sharp.

Tip Number 4

Don’t forget to apply through our website! We’re always on the lookout for talented developers like you. Plus, it’s a straightforward way to get your application noticed by our team.

We think you need these skills to ace Low Latency Java Developer in London

Java
Low Latency Programming Techniques
Performance Optimization
High-Performance Data Structures
Multithreading
Concurrent Programming
Network Protocols

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ights your experience in low latency trading systems and Java development.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ects and achievements!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Use it to explain why you’re passionate about low latency systems and how your background fits our needs. Let us know what excites you about working in Capital Markets.

Showcase Your Problem-Solving Skills:In your application, give examples of how you've tackled performance tuning or latency issues in past projects. We love seeing candidates who can think critically and solve complex problems, especially in high-pressure environments.

Apply Through Our Website:We encourage you to apply directly through our website for the best chance of getting noticed. It’s super easy, and you’ll be able to keep track of your application status. Plus, we love seeing applications come in through our own channels!

How to prepare for a job interview at Synechron

Know Your Java Inside Out

Make sure you brush up on your Java skills, especially around low latency programming techniques. Be prepared to discuss specific projects where you've implemented high-performance data structures or multithreading, as this will show your depth of knowledge.

Understand the Capital Markets Landscape

Familiarise yourself with the latest trends in algorithmic and high-frequency trading. Being able to discuss current market dynamics and how they impact trading systems will demonstrate your passion and relevance in the field.

Prepare for Technical Challenges

Expect to face technical questions or coding challenges during the interview. Practise solving problems related to performance tuning and latency profiling, as these are crucial for the role. Use platforms like LeetCode or HackerRank to sharpen your skills.

Showcase Your Collaboration Skills

Since the role involves working closely with quantitative teams and traders, be ready to share examples of how you've successfully collaborated in the past. Highlight your communication skills and how you’ve contributed to optimising systems for ultra-low latency execution.